Airline Accessories has the following current assets: cash, $109 million; receivables, $101 million; inventory, $189 million; and other current assets, $25 million. Airline Accessories has the following liabilities: accounts payable, $112 million; current portion of long-term debt, $42 million; and long-term debt, $30 million. Based on these amounts, calculate the current ratio and the acid-test ratio for Airline Accessories. (Enter your answers in millions, not in dollars.) Current Ratio Acid-Test Ratio
